The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, In Plain Words

You might be curious about how your body produces growth hormone, especially as you age. This is where a specific GHRH analog comes into play. This compounded peptide works by stimulating your pituitary gland, the master gland of your endocrine system, to release its own growth hormone. Think of it as a gentle nudge to your body’s natural hormone production system. It mimics the body’s natural pulsatile release pattern. This differs from synthetic growth hormone injections.

The primary goal of this therapy is to help restore more youthful levels of growth hormone and its downstream metabolite, IGF-1. Frequently Asked Questions About This Therapy

How is Sermorelin different from HGH?

Sermorelin acetate is a GHRH analog that stimulates your body’s own pituitary gland to produce and release growth hormone. It encourages a natural, pulsatile release. Human Growth Hormone (HGH) therapy involves directly injecting synthetic growth hormone into your body. The former works with your body’s existing systems, while the latter introduces an external hormone.

Can I get Sermorelin without a prescription?

No, you cannot legally obtain compounded sermorelin acetate without a prescription from a licensed medical professional. Regulations require a thorough health evaluation to ensure the therapy is safe and appropriate for you. Telehealth platforms facilitate this process by connecting you with qualified doctors who can assess your needs.

What lab tests are usually required?

Your clinician will likely order blood tests to establish baseline levels. These commonly include IGF-1 (Insulin-like Growth Factor 1), which is a key indicator of growth hormone activity. They may also check fasting glucose levels to monitor blood sugar and other relevant markers to get a complete picture of your health.
